Zhu Wei: A Contemporary Voice in Chinese Ink Painting Born in Beijing, China, in 1966, Zhu Wei is a prominent contemporary Chinese artist recognized for his subtly critical engagement with politics and society within the rapidly evolving landscape of modern China. He stands as one of the most visible practitioners of post-Tiananmen era art, demonstrating a remarkable fidelity to traditional Chinese painting while simultaneously offering a nuanced commentary on its historical context.
